Salary Range & Percentiles
Pay distribution across experience levels
10th Percentile — Entry Level$54,419
25th Percentile — Junior$67,672
50th Percentile — Median$79,097
75th Percentile — Senior$97,490
90th Percentile — Top Earners$107,979

Librarians and Media Collections Specialists Job Market in Maryland
Key factors affecting compensation

Maryland is home to a strong job market for Librarians and Media Collections Specialistss. The state's key industries — Government, Healthcare, Technology — generate significant demand for skilled professionals. At $82,030 per year, Maryland's Librarians and Media Collections Specialists salaries are 15.0% higher than the national average.

The cost of living in Maryland (index: 1.15) justifies the higher pay scale. Entry-level professionals in Maryland can expect to earn $54,419–$67,672, while experienced Librarians and Media Collections Specialistss can command $97,490–$107,979.
